A huge world to explore is great, but only if it is filled with interesting places to explore and fantastic characters to interact with. A large map with lots of nothing outside of isolated hubs of activity is not my idea of a good time. I want a game world that has surprises around every corner, and leads to a heightened sense of anticipation for what may be in store for you around that corner that you haven't even considered might be possible.
